Output e76e953948fb1900500aeebd8c72bfc047ed63cacb431a320db9bbfb052af895:6

value
31424160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e627c212b4ea68b632e9a84f7adf3d770aa5a8f OP_EQUAL
address
3DDH3ZfBQLxTYbBd9QzioTJ7oriN4jdbH7
transaction
e76e953948fb1900500aeebd8c72bfc047ed63cacb431a320db9bbfb052af895
confirmations
380133
spent
true